Piaya melanogaster

Identification

  • Black belly and crissum
  • Grey cap
  • Red bill
  • Yellow loral spots

Distribution

Bolivia, Brazil, Colombia, Ecuador, French Guiana, Guyana, Peru, Suriname, and Venezuela.

Taxonomy

This is most often considered a monotypic species, however, some authorities recognize melanogaster and ochracea.

Habitat

Forest and low scrubby woodland areas.

Behaviour

It feeds in the canopy and the diet includes insects, beetles, ants and caterpillars.
